gpt4 book ai didi

javascript - 从 REACT.jsx 中的用户输入中获取数字的最后五位

转载 作者:行者123 更新时间:2023-11-28 14:09:04 26 4
gpt4 key购买 nike

基本上,我目前正在使用 this.props.x (这是用户输入)从另一个页面获取信息。所以 this.props.x 是一个数字,例如“12345 12345 54321”,分为三组 5 位数字。我想用星号替换前 10 位数字并保留最后 5 位数字。如何操作 this.props.x 才能实现这一点?

谢谢。

这是我尝试过的。

{this.props.x ? (
<p>
Card number: <br />
{"***** *****" + this.props.x}
</p>
) : (
""
)

我希望最终结果看起来像***** ***** 54321

最佳答案

如果 x 是一个(整数)数字,那么它不能有空格,并且所有 15 位数字将在一起。在这种情况下,您可以使用类似的东西

{"***** *****" + (this.props.x % 100000)}

如果它是一个像您在问题中提到的字符串,每 5 个字符后有一个空格,那么您可以使用 Array.prototype.slice()

{"***** *****" + (this.props.x.slice(12)}

关于javascript - 从 REACT.jsx 中的用户输入中获取数字的最后五位,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/60229981/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com